Security Engineer 

London - £40,000 - £60,000 + Bonus + Benefits

 

 A widely recognised financial organisation is seeking a Security Engineer to join a growing security team. A core component of the organisations continued growth and success is their excellent IT function. As a Security Engineer, you’ll have a fundamental role in ensuring all cyber risks to the organisation are managed and maintained effectively. Beyond the day-to-day, however, you will also be involved in longer-term projects that are critical to the future proofing of the organisation from threat including design and testing, as well as ensuring that standards and policies are adhered to.

 

 Responsibilities:

 

  • Design and implement safety measures and data recovery plans
  • Install, configure and upgrade security software (e.g. antivirus programs)
  • Secure networks through firewalls, password protection and other systems
  • Investigate, isolate, and resolve infrastructure and network errors both autonomously and with the support of other IT staff/ 3rd party vendors with minimal downtime
  • Inspect hardware for vulnerable points of access
  • Monitor network activity to identify issues early and communicate them to IT teams
  • Act on privacy breaches and malware threats
  • Draft policies and guidelines
  • Serve as a security expert and advise other members of the organisation were necessary

 

 

Skills:

  • Proven experience in an IT Security position
  • BSc/BA in Computer Science, Information Technology or a related field would be ideal
  • Hold a professional security certification (e.g. CompTIA Security+, CISSP, SSCP)
  • Experience installing, supporting and maintaining IT security
  • Exceptional Knowledge of patch management, firewalls and intrusion detection/prevention systems (e.g. TippingPoint, Languard)
  • Ideally from an IT infrastructure background but you will at least have a general understanding of key infrastructure including network, servers, storage, software systems and cloud technologies
  • Familiarity with security frameworks (e.g. IS27001, COBIT, SOC2, PCI DSS).
  • Exceptional communication skills with the ability to communicate with both internal and external stakeholders.
  • Familiarity with the new GDPR regulations
